Did you know that the park closes at sunset? Yes, all visitors must be off of the park’s trails by sunset.
This March we will hike into the eastern edge of the park at sunset as we explore the natural sandstone trails and creek crossings of Council Overhang, Ottawa Canyon, and Kaskaskia Canyon. Park Naturalist Lisa Sons will tell the tales of human inhabitation in the area dating as far back as 10,000 years ago or the end of the last ice age.
Plan to dress for the weather and wear waterproof/mudproof boots as well as a change of shoes and socks after the hike is done!
Don't forget your headlamp or small flashlight.
Night hikes are not recommended for young children and dogs are not allowed. Thank you for understanding.
